Now a few things...

- If the only thing you're going to have on your homepage is the picture of the car, resize it so it fits on the page without scrolling. This is tricky because everyone has a different resolution.
- You might want to add some sort of blurb on the home page to catch people's attention. Some catchy phrase or something. Right now, I see a picture of a car and it doesn't tell me anything.
- See if you can resize your Banner so that the glow doesn't bleed past the borders. That way it doesn't look chopped off and there is uniform black around the letters.
- The "Premium Auto Detailing" is kind of hard to read. Too busy.
- You are using different fonts on different pages for the detail text. You usually want to stay consistent with the font from page to page. Also, the font you used on the Prices page is a Serif type font (it has little ticks at the ends of the letters). The "norm" for web pages is to use a Sans Serif font like the ones used for your About Me page. They are easier to read via web browser.
- There's a Domain Name link at the bottom of the page that doesn't need to be there.
